Katara Cultural Village is a vibrant cultural hub in Doha, Qatar, where people come together to celebrate the culture of Qatar and the world. This expansive area hosts numerous exhibitions and festivals annually and features architectural marvels such as the Amphitheatre, Opera House, Cultural Hall, the beautiful Blue Mosque, and the Gold Mosque. Visitors can admire stunning sculptures and savour diverse cuisines at restaurants from around the world. Discover Pearl Island in Doha, Qatar—an expansive and luxurious development spanning four million square meters of reclaimed land. Boasting 32 kilometres of stunning coastline, this vibrant community is home to 52,000 residents and offers 25,000 elegant residences. Experience upscale shopping, gourmet dining, lush parks, and a range of recreational activities. Souq Waqif in Doha is a bustling market that blends traditional Qatari architecture with vibrant cultural experiences. Visitors can explore shops filled with spices, handcrafted goods, and unique souvenirs, visit the famous falcon market, and enjoy areas dedicated to animals like horses and camels. The souq also offers authentic Qatari cuisine, live music, and cultural performances, with nearby attractions including the Museum of Islamic Art and Doha Corniche. Whether shopping, dining, or soaking in the lively atmosphere, Souq Waqif provides an immersive experience of Qatar's rich heritage.

Experience the charm of a traditional wooden dhow boat, a classic vessel once used by merchants and pearl divers, now updated with modern comforts. Enjoy 30 minute cruise around Doha's stunning skyline, sailing through the calm teal waters of the Arabic Gulf. As the dhow moves along the Corniche, you’ll get amazing views of both old and new Doha from the sea.
